Following God's Lead: Lessons from the Story of Joshua

In life, there are moments when we face challenges and uncertainties.

It is in these moments that we must learn to follow God's lead.

The story of Joshua provides valuable insights into how we can navigate through the Jordan Rivers in our lives.


When the Israelites stood at the edge of the Jordan River, they had been promised the land on the other side.

However, the river stood as a barrier between them and their promise.

Instead of removing the obstacle, God opened a way through it.

He instructed the people to follow the Ark of the Covenant, a symbol of His presence, and to keep a distance from it. This act signified their trust in God's guidance and their reverence for His holiness.


The Israelites had never traveled this way before, and they had to trust that God would lead them safely across the river.

It required faith and courage for them to take that first step into the unknown.

Similarly, in our lives, we often find ourselves standing at the edge of our own Jordan Rivers – facing challenges, uncertainties, and opportunities.

It is during these times that God calls us to step out in faith, trusting Him to guide us through.


Before crossing the Jordan River, Joshua commanded the people to purify themselves and consecrate their lives.

This act of consecration involved cleansing themselves and aligning their lives with God's purposes.

It was a call to spiritual preparation, recognizing that they were about to enter into the promised land and experience God's wonders among them.

In our own lives, we must also take the time to consecrate ourselves before God, surrendering our sins and aligning our hearts with His will.


As the Israelites crossed the Jordan River, they witnessed God's faithfulness and power firsthand.

He made a way where there seemed to be no way, parting the waters and leading them through.

It was a reminder that God's presence and provision were with them every step of the way.

As we face our own Jordan Rivers, we can take comfort in knowing that God is with us. He is faithful to guide us, protect us, and lead us to the promises He has for our lives.
